Much disturbed. Of the complete circular enclosure marked 'Fort' on the OS 1836 ed. all that remains is a steep scarp running from NNE-E-S. Modern farm buildings occupy the remainder of the site. Situated on the summit of a drumlin hill.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Cavan'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1995).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
